About this ebook

The book is really pragmatic, focusing on the key aspects you usually need to create an application. We skip the boring theory and jump straight to the action. Also, the examples don’t try to be perfect, they just show the topic in question or the tool/components we are using. Here the focus is on the framework itself not on how to architect applications. The book will spend a lot of time reviewing the examples and each chapter is created around the example used to explain the topics so the example is first, then the explanation.This book is great for you if you are new to Zend Framework 2 and are looking to get a practical approach in how to use the framework. This book will be also really helpful if you are a Zend Framework 1 user but you want to adapt you knowledge to the new version of the framework. It’s assumed that you will have good experience using PHP and specially with the Object Oriented programming paradigm.

About the author

Christopher Valles is a Software Engineer from Barcelona, Spain, currently based in London, UK. He started developing when he was seven using a Vtech kid laptop that was strangely shipped with a simple version of the BASIC programming language. Since then, he has explored more than 16 different programming languages ranging from Assembler to PHP, Python, and GO. Chris also stepped into the sysadmin role and has been managing systems since he started working in this industry. He has taken care of servers right from simple webservers to infrastructures on the Cloud and internal Mac infrastructures. He is an Apple Certified Support Professional and Apple Certified Technical Coordinator. His desire to learn and experiment has driven him to explore other fields, such as machine learning and robotics. He currently owns close to five robots and has built more than 20 over the past years. If you don't find him on the computer, he is probably spending time in the kitchen cooking delicious recipes. The sectors where Chris has worked ranges from adult content websites and payment processors to social networks and the gaming industry. Presently, he's working as a Software Engineer at Hailo Networks, Ltd.
